Output ef862c9fff7807c82d34345e971085b4259b062e5413768e21e7eff1f5c62754:0

value
38582
script pubkey
OP_HASH160 OP_PUSHBYTES_20 76b71742d23386d1e79b0523740e76b6a0a406df OP_EQUAL
address
3CWizZCUDXWNZ8GsDhAnxUzcYzMWBTdE7E
transaction
ef862c9fff7807c82d34345e971085b4259b062e5413768e21e7eff1f5c62754